Former National Security Committee Chairman transferred from hospital to remand prison

AKIPRESS.COM - Former State National Security Committee Chairman Abdil Segizbaev was transferred from hospital to the remand prison of the State National Security Committee, his lawyer Kantemir Turdaliev told AKIpress.
The lawyer said his client tested negative for coronavirus infection.
"He still feels weakness. According to the recommendations of the Ministry of Health, around 5 days of rehabilitation are needed after discharge from hospital, people after coronavirus should be isolated, an isolated and well-ventilated room is needed. There are no such conditions in the remand prison," lawyer Kantemir Turdaliev stated.
Abdil Segizbaev was transferred from the remand prison to the hospital on May 24 after he was diagnosed double pneumonia.
